Building Information Modeling (BIM) enables smarter, more connected project delivery.Our BIM services create accurate and data-rich 3D models for buildings and infrastructure.We integrate architectural, structural, and MEP disciplines into coordinated BIM models.Our process helps identify design clashes before construction begins.

Detailed BIM documentation improves project accuracy and construction planning.We support better collaboration among architects, engineers, contractors, and stakeholders.Our BIM solutions help reduce rework, project delays, and construction costs.From design development to construction, we deliver reliable BIM solutions for efficient project execution.

Yes. We work from the Engineer of Record’s calculations, design specifications, and equipment data, translating engineering requirements into detailed mechanical fabrication, manufacturing, and installation drawings.
We work to the applicable mechanical engineering codes and standards required by the project and jurisdiction, including ASME, ISO, BS EN, AS/NZS, and Indian Standards (IS). All applicable codes and project requirements are confirmed at the start of the project.
Yes. We develop detailed 3D fabrication models to support manufacturing and installation, including assemblies, components, fabrication details, and associated production documentation in accordance with project requirements.
We maintain a controlled revision management process, tracking all engineering changes and updating drawings, models, and documentation within the agreed turnaround timeframe. All revisions are clearly identified, documented, and coordinated to ensure compliance with project requirements and approved design specifications.
